    Fast food gets really boring really fast, especially on road trips. Thank goodness Main Street Eatery isn't located too far from the freeway. This cute mom and pop shop serves a variety of good eats ranging from different types of burgers to sandwiches to salads to breakfast items (only available between opening to 11am). I stopped here yesterday (Tuesday of Thanksgiving) at around 1pm. You're suppose to seat yourself, but the staff came by quickly. Michelle was very patient and courteous, turns out she's the owner and shared her story of how Main Street Eatery opened! I'm surprised that this use to be a hot dog stand! I ordered the 1/2 veggie quesadilla with a side salad. The portion was huge, I ate 2 out of the 4 slices and boxed up the rest. I liked how real mushrooms and bell peppers were used and the entree tasted similar to home-cooking. Many places use canned ingredients, but at Main Street Eatery, you get the real deal. Restrooms are inside the laundromat next door, but they also share a door so you don't have to go outside. Ample parking, I'll be back again if I'm passing through. Thanks Michelle for the cool history lesson of the camels!

    The place is the best stop in Quartzite for solid home cookin'! It's our favorite stop when traveling between AZ and CA. The food is great the service is ALWAYS friendly and you may wait to get seated, but your food will be served in a timely fashion and always good and hot! (Or cold if that's what you've ordered...:-) Unfortunately, if you want to try this place, (and you do) you'll need to hurry. Due to illness and a divorce, the Quartzite staple will be closing on Mar27, 2022.
